|
@@ -224,22 +224,6 @@ static int ade7754_reset(struct device *dev)
|
|
|
return ade7754_spi_write_reg_8(dev, ADE7754_OPMODE, val);
|
|
|
}
|
|
|
|
|
|
-
|
|
|
-static ssize_t ade7754_write_reset(struct device *dev,
|
|
|
- struct device_attribute *attr,
|
|
|
- const char *buf, size_t len)
|
|
|
-{
|
|
|
- if (len < 1)
|
|
|
- return -1;
|
|
|
- switch (buf[0]) {
|
|
|
- case '1':
|
|
|
- case 'y':
|
|
|
- case 'Y':
|
|
|
- return ade7754_reset(dev);
|
|
|
- }
|
|
|
- return -1;
|
|
|
-}
|
|
|
-
|
|
|
static IIO_DEV_ATTR_AENERGY(ade7754_read_24bit, ADE7754_AENERGY);
|
|
|
static IIO_DEV_ATTR_LAENERGY(ade7754_read_24bit, ADE7754_LAENERGY);
|
|
|
static IIO_DEV_ATTR_VAENERGY(ade7754_read_24bit, ADE7754_VAENERGY);
|
|
@@ -478,8 +462,6 @@ static IIO_DEV_ATTR_SAMP_FREQ(S_IWUSR | S_IRUGO,
|
|
|
ade7754_read_frequency,
|
|
|
ade7754_write_frequency);
|
|
|
|
|
|
-static IIO_DEV_ATTR_RESET(ade7754_write_reset);
|
|
|
-
|
|
|
static IIO_CONST_ATTR_SAMP_FREQ_AVAIL("26000 13000 65000 33000");
|
|
|
|
|
|
static struct attribute *ade7754_attributes[] = {
|
|
@@ -488,7 +470,6 @@ static struct attribute *ade7754_attributes[] = {
|
|
|
&iio_const_attr_in_temp_scale.dev_attr.attr,
|
|
|
&iio_dev_attr_sampling_frequency.dev_attr.attr,
|
|
|
&iio_const_attr_sampling_frequency_available.dev_attr.attr,
|
|
|
- &iio_dev_attr_reset.dev_attr.attr,
|
|
|
&iio_dev_attr_aenergy.dev_attr.attr,
|
|
|
&iio_dev_attr_laenergy.dev_attr.attr,
|
|
|
&iio_dev_attr_vaenergy.dev_attr.attr,
|